Output c4932894f2e13b2ea34c71ff3fd4e8a709556bb3f57dbb3d166275f1d0002108:2

value
45535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86283720d51427ed3a2434341c0e2f0412be83de OP_EQUAL
address
3DvNeTeFvJyLLbftmVyDgmjZC6iZ4xtqNu
transaction
c4932894f2e13b2ea34c71ff3fd4e8a709556bb3f57dbb3d166275f1d0002108
confirmations
112640
spent
true